City of Pasadena says Mayor Thomas Schoenbein has made ‘significant improvement’ following medical emergency

City of Pasadena

PASADENA, Texas – The City of Pasadena provided an update on Mayor Thomas Schoenbein after he suffered a medical emergency Monday and was flown to a hospital.

While the city says Schoenbeim remains at Memorial Hermann Hospital and his condition remains guarded, he has made significant improvements in the past 24 hours.

“Mayor Schoenbein is in good spirits and has expressed deep gratitude for the outpouring of love, care, and support he and his family have received. Your continued prayers and encouragement mean the world to him and make a real difference during this time,” the city said in a statement.

The incident happened around 1:15 p.m. on Monday. He was flown to the hospital by helicopter.

Schoenbein was elected Mayor of Pasadena in the municipal runoff election held on June 7, 2025.

Later Tuesday evening, Schoenbein posted on Facebook, saying he is expected to make a full recovery.
